Tips and Tricks for Dynamons 5

The game’s main gameplay consists of riveting turn-based battles. Use the action cards to attack, and catch the opposing creature when it’s weakened. By selecting the backpack during battle, you can access any special items you have gathered. Use shards to level up your Dynamons, and to gain new action cards. Challenge other trainers and become the strongest Dynamon Captain!

You can play the game using touchscreen controls or your mouse.
